Understanding Fractions: A Chart for Basic Definitions

One of the foundational concepts in fractions is understanding what a fraction is. A basic anchor chart should clearly define key terms such as numerator and denominator.

Fraction Definition: A fraction represents a part of a whole.

Numerator: The top number in a fraction, indicating how many parts are being considered.

Denominator: The bottom number in a fraction, showing how many equal parts the whole is divided into.

Visual Representation: An illustration of a pie chart or a number line can provide a clear visual reference for students.

Types of Fractions: A Chart for Classification

Understanding the different types of fractions is crucial for students. An anchor chart that categorizes fractions helps children identify and differentiate them.

Proper Fractions: Fractions where the numerator is less than the denominator.

Improper Fractions: Fractions where the numerator is greater than or equal to the denominator.

Mixed Numbers: A whole number combined with a proper fraction.

Including examples for each type can further enhance understanding.

Fraction Equivalence: A Chart to Explain Equal Values

A significant aspect of working with fractions is understanding equivalence. This anchor chart can showcase how different fractions can represent the same value.

Fraction Equivalence: Different fractions that are equal in value.

Visual Examples: Use diagrams that show how 1/2 is equivalent to 2/4 and 4/8.

Color coding can help emphasize the connections between equivalent fractions.

Adding and Subtracting Fractions: A Step-by-Step Guide

Adding and subtracting fractions can be challenging for students. An anchor chart that provides a step-by-step process can be invaluable.

Common Denominator: The first step is to find a common denominator for unlike fractions.

Add or Subtract: Once the fractions have common denominators, add or subtract the numerators.

Simplify: Finally, simplify the result if necessary.

Including examples for both addition and subtraction processes can serve as a reference for students during practice.

Multiplying Fractions: A Visual Process Chart

Multiplying fractions involves a straightforward process, but students often need support to remember the steps. This anchor chart can outline the process clearly.

Multiply Numerators: The first step is to multiply the numerators of the fractions.

Multiply Denominators: Next, multiply the denominators.

Simplify: Lastly, simplify the resulting fraction if possible.

Visual aids and examples can help clarify the process, making it easier for students to grasp.

Dividing Fractions: Understanding the Inverse Operation

Division of fractions can be particularly confusing for students. An anchor chart that explains the concept of “multiplying by the reciprocal” can be highly effective.

Reciprocal: The reciprocal of a fraction is obtained by flipping the numerator and denominator.

Multiply: To divide by a fraction, multiply by its reciprocal.

Simplify: Simplification of the resulting fraction may be necessary.

Using visual representations can help students understand this concept more easily.

Fraction Word Problems: Strategies for Solving

Word problems involving fractions require students to translate text into mathematical expressions. An anchor chart that outlines strategies can guide them through this process.

Read Carefully: Encourage students to read the problem multiple times.

Identify Fractions: Have students underline or highlight the fractions mentioned in the problem.

Choose an Operation: Help students determine whether to add, subtract, multiply, or divide.

Solve and Check: Encourage students to solve the problem and then check their work.

Including a sample word problem with a solution can provide a practical illustration.

Fraction Models: Visual Representations for Better Understanding

Using models is an effective way to teach fractions. An anchor chart displaying different models can help students visualize fractions better.

Pie Models: Illustrate fractions using circles divided into equal parts.

Bar Models: Use rectangles to show fractions as parts of a whole.

Number Lines: Demonstrate fractions on a number line for a linear representation.

Visual representations can cater to various learning styles, enhancing overall comprehension.

Comparing Fractions: Strategies for Determining Greater or Lesser Values

Comparing fractions is another crucial skill. An anchor chart that outlines strategies for comparing fractions can aid students in making these determinations.

Same Denominator: If fractions have the same denominator, compare numerators.

Same Numerator: If fractions have the same numerator, compare denominators.

Cross-Multiplication: For fractions with different numerators and denominators, cross-multiply to determine which is larger.

Including examples can help solidify these strategies.

Fraction Games: Interactive Learning Opportunities

Incorporating games into learning can make fractions more engaging. An anchor chart that lists fraction games can inspire creativity in lessons.

Fraction Bingo: Create bingo cards with fractions for a fun review.

Matching Games: Use cards with fractions and their equivalent decimal or percentage forms.

Fraction Puzzles: Have students assemble puzzles that depict fractional relationships.

Games can be an effective way to reinforce learning while making it enjoyable.

Real-World Applications: Connecting Fractions to Everyday Life

Demonstrating how fractions are used in everyday life can enhance student interest and relevance. An anchor chart that illustrates real-world applications can be enlightening.

Cooking: Fractions are used in recipes to measure ingredients.

Budgeting: Fractions help in understanding and managing money, such as discounts and savings.

Construction: Fractions are essential in measuring and cutting materials accurately.

Connecting fractions to real-life situations can help students appreciate their importance.
